Chinese hamster ovary cells have been treated with bleomycin at various stages in the cell cycle. Mitotic cells, which exhibit least survival, show the greatest amount of DNA strand breakage and a marked inhibition of DNA replication in the subsequent S phase. Treatment of exponentially growing Chinese hamster ovary cells with bleomycin causes a dose-dependent decrease in cell survival due to DNA damage. This lethal effect can be potentiated by the addition of a nonlethal dose of the anticalmodulin drug N-(4-aminobutyl)-5-chloro-2-naphthalenesulfonamide ( W13 ) but not its inactive analog N-(4-aminobutyl)-2-naphthalenesulfonamide ( W12 ).
